Little Music Essentials is a piano program designed for kids ages 4-6. We use an awardwinning curriculum comprised of singing, dancing, and ear training to foster your child's love for music!

For this month's Student Spotlight, I nominate Nixen Roff. Nixen is six years old and he's one of my Little Music Essentials students. He's only been playing piano for about four months and he's already grown so much. I love his excitement for music and his diligence in playing the piano. When he plays a wrong note in class, he's quick to say "Let's start over" and tries it again from the beginning. Nixen is very intelligent and I know he'll do amazing things!
